So if a potential fight between Manny and Floyd did go down i fail to see why the weight is an issue at all. When Manny faced Oscar he weighed 148 in the ring. That fight was at Welterweight. When Manny faced Hatton he came in to the ring once again weighing 148. That fight was at Light-Welterweight. So as you can see regardless of whether Pacquiao faces Floyd at Light-Welter or Welter he will weigh exactly the same. Couple this with Mayweather weighing pretty much exactly the same, at most a pound or 2 more and the fight would be even regardless of weight. So if the fight is at Welter you should all realise it makes no difference than if the fight is at Light-Welter.
